Introducing our new homeowner family, pictured here at the site of their new home. Daughter, Diamond, and sons, Jameer and Jaimel, posing with mom, Chiquista Massey. They will be working with us to help build their new home on Usher Road in Lancaster.

Although most of the sitework is completed, we still need sponsors and supporters to get construction underway and reach our funding goal to complete the home.


As you probably know, prices for building materials have increased dramatically, so it’s become more challenging to build an affordable home. However, we are resolved to stay true to our mission and not let the economic effects of Covid-19 prevent us from serving our community! With your sponsorships and donations, we can succeed!

About Habitat for Humanity of Lancaster County

Habitat for Humanity of Lancaster County has an open-door policy: All who believe that everyone needs a decent, affordable place to live are welcome to help with the work, regardless of race, religion, age, gender, political views or any of the other distinctions that too often divide people. In short, Habitat welcomes volunteers and supporters from all backgrounds and also serves people in need of decent housing regardless of race or religion. As a matter of policy, Habitat for Humanity International and its affiliated organizations do not proselytize. This means that Habitat will not offer assistance on the expressed or implied condition that people must either adhere to or convert to a particular faith, or listen and respond to messaging designed to induce conversion to a particular faith.
